Safety Guidelines for Hazardous Voltages
(Spring Terminal Products)
If hazardous voltages are connected to the device, take the following precautions. A hazardous voltage is a voltage greater than 42.4 V peak voltage or 60 V DC to earth ground.
You may connect signals which may be floating at hazardous voltages only to the products with screw terminal or spring terminal connectors. Do not connect signals which may be floating at hazardous voltages to the products with DSUB or LEMO connectors.
Safety Guidelines for Hazardous Locations
These products have been evaluated as Ex ec IIC T4 Gc equipment and are CCC certified. Each product is suitable for use within ambient temperatures of -40 °C ≤ Ta ≤ 70 °C in either nonhazardous locations or Zone 2 hazardous locations. If you are using the products in Gas Group IIC hazardous locations, you must use the device in an NI chassis that has been evaluated as Ex ec IIC T4 Gc equipment.
Follow these guidelines if you are installing the product in a potentially explosive environment. Not following these guidelines may result in serious injury or death.

Safety Compliance and Hazardous Locations Standards
This product is designed to meet the requirements of the following electrical equipment safety standards for measurement, control, and laboratory use:
- IEC 61010-1
- IEC 60079-0, IEC 60079-7
- GB/T3836.1, GB/T3836.3
